Kurt D. Svendsen
Kurt Svendsen is vice president of technology at The Toro Company. In his role, Kurt has responsibility for digital innovation and creative technology solutions to help to further accelerate the company’s strategies for alternative power, smart-connected and autonomous products. He oversees The Toro Company’s Center for Technology, Research and Innovation (CTRI) and enterprise information technology teams.
Prior to joining The Toro Company in 1999, Kurt held information technology roles of increasing responsibility at Andersen Consulting and Medtronic. During his time with The Toro Company, he has held various leadership positions including vice president of strategy, corporate and channel development and vice president of information services.
He received a Bachelor of Science in electrical and computer engineering from the University of Wisconsin – Madison, as well as an MBA from the University of Minnesota – Carlson School of Management.
